Ankur Tripathi

(IAS | Assam Meghalya | 2025)
Ankur Tripathi, born on November 15, 1993, is an Indian Administrative Service officer from the 2025 batch. He serves in the Assam Meghalaya cadre. Currently in service, Mr. Tripathi is part of the esteemed IAS, contributing to public administration and governance.
